Factors influencing moving costs from Cincinnati to New Hampshire

The cost of Cincinnati movers will depend on:

  • Move size: The number of belongings you’re moving will directly affect your overall moving costs, along with your home’s size and layout.
  • Time of year: Moving prices usually go up in the summer, which is peak moving season in Cincinnati.
  • DIY vs. professional mover: Choosing to move yourself is typically less expensive, but it also means more effort and hassle than hiring professional movers.

Other considerations when moving to New Hampshire from Cincinnati

If you’re relocating from Cincinnati to New Hampshire, there’s more involved than simply packing up and hiring movers. Don’t forget to look into local regulations, permits, and any other logistics that could impact your move.

  • Truck parking permits: Some cities ask for parking permits when you’re using a moving truck or large vehicle. Check in advance to see if you’ll need a permit for your move.
  • State licensing: The New Hampshire Department of Transportation (NHDOT) is the agency tasked with regulating and overseeing movers that offer relocation services within the state. If you’ve already moved and had a dispute with your moving company, they may be able to help resolve the issue, but you’ll need to file a formal complaint first. Double-check that your moving company is fully licensed before you hire them.
  • State regulator: You can check a New Hampshire moving license anytime on the state’s official regulatory website.
  • Moving permits: There’s no need for a moving permit in New Hampshire, but be sure to look up local parking rules before moving day.
  • Change of address: Be sure to fill out your USPS change of address form at least a week before your move. You can set your official move date so your mail is forwarded to New Hampshire without any hiccups. Start here.
  • Moving insurance: Insurance requirements vary by state, so be sure to review the regulations where you live. Choose Released Value Protection for a cost-free, minimal coverage option from movers. They're responsible for a maximum of 60 cents per pound per article. For comprehensive coverage, discuss alternatives with your moving company or consider a third-party insurance provider.
